Course Content

• Introduction to High-Tech Materials for Outdoor Equipment
• Polymer Composites for Outdoor Applications (strength, durability, lightweighting)
• Advanced Materials Characterization and Testing (mechanical, thermal, chemical)
• Sustainable and Bio-Based Materials in Outdoor Gear
• Design and Manufacturing of High-Tech Outdoor Products
• Failure Analysis and Durability of Outdoor Equipment
• Textile Materials and Technologies for Outdoor Apparel (waterproofing, breathability)
• Surface Treatments and Coatings for Enhanced Performance

Career Role Description
Materials Scientist (High-Tech Materials) Research, develop, and test new high-performance materials for outdoor equipment, focusing on durability and sustainability.
Composite Materials Engineer Specialize in designing and manufacturing advanced composite materials like carbon fiber and Kevlar for lightweight yet strong equipment.
Research and Development (R&D) Specialist (Outdoor Gear) Lead innovation by exploring novel high-tech materials and manufacturing processes for cutting-edge outdoor products.
Product Development Engineer (High-Performance Textiles) Focus on the development and implementation of high-tech textiles with enhanced properties like waterproofing, breathability, and durability.
Quality Control Specialist (Outdoor Equipment) Ensure the quality and performance of high-tech materials used in outdoor equipment meet stringent standards.
